China calls for loosening North Korea sanctions despite recent missile tests

UN ambassador cites humanitarianism, but expert says Beijing more interested in signaling support to Pyongyang

China’s ambassador to the U.N. urged the U.N. Security Council (UNSC) to relax North Korean sanctions on Thursday, a day after his U.S. counterpart called for more rigid enforcement of the current sanctions regime.

Ambassador Zhang Jun, repeating a position China has advocated for years, said in a press conference that the U.N. should roll back DPRK sanctions.

“It has always been China’s view that we should also address the humanitarian dimension caused by the sanctions imposed by the Security Council. We [have] seen negative impact because of the sanctions,” Zhang said.
